A heavy, wide sans with broad proportions, compact counters, and smooth, rounded curves paired with blunt terminals. The strokes are consistently thick with modest contrast, and the construction favors simple geometric shapes—circular bowls, sturdy horizontals, and squared-off joins that keep the silhouette dense and stable. Lowercase forms read as single‑storey and utilitarian, while the numerals are wide and bold with clear, open apertures and strong horizontal emphasis.

This font is best suited to display applications where maximum impact is desired—headlines, posters, large-format signage, and bold brand marks. It also works well for packaging and promotional graphics where wide, dark letterforms help maintain presence from a distance.

The overall tone is confident and attention-grabbing, with a contemporary, sporty feel. Its wide stance and dense color give it a bold, no-nonsense voice that feels energetic and promotional rather than delicate or editorial.

The design appears intended to deliver strong visibility and a modern, approachable toughness: wide, simplified forms that print with authority while keeping curves friendly and contemporary. It prioritizes bold presence and quick recognition over delicate detail.

Spacing and sidebearings appear generous enough to keep the heavy weight from clumping, especially in the sample text, while the wide proportions maintain legibility at display sizes. The shapes lean more toward rounded geometry than strict rectilinear construction, softening the otherwise very strong, block-like presence.
